데이터베이스에서 요청 양식의 사용자 지정 속성을 채울 값을 검색하려고 할 때 사용자 지정 속성을 추가하여 해당 데이터베이스를 쿼리합니다. 데이터베이스 사용자 지정 속성은 vRealize Orchestrator 작업을 사용하여 쿼리를 실행하고 값을 검색합니다.

이 작업은 다음 데이터베이스에 대해 지원됩니다.

  • Microsoft SQL Server

  • MySQL

  • Oracle

  • PostgreSQL

제한 사항

검색된 모든 값은 문자열으로 변환됩니다.

사전 요구 사항

vRealize Orchestrator SQL 플러그인이 설치되었으며 대상 데이터베이스에 연결되도록 구성되었는지 확인합니다.

사용자 지정 속성 구성 값

이 옵션은 사용자 지정 속성을 생성하는 데 사용합니다. 일반적인 단계는 vRealize Orchestrator 작업 사용자 지정 속성 정의 생성 항목을 참조하십시오.

표 1. 데이터베이스 쿼리 사용자 지정 속성 구성 값

옵션

이름

모든 문자열을 사용할 수 있습니다.

데이터 유형

문자열

다음으로 표시

드롭다운

외부

작업 폴더

com.vmware.vra.sql

스크립트 작업

executeSQLSelectOnDatabase

이 스크립트 작업은 스크립트 예입니다. 환경에 대한 특정 작업을 생성할 수 있습니다.

입력 매개 변수

  • databaseName. vRealize Orchestrator가 연결된 데이터베이스의 이름입니다.

  • sqlSelectQuery. 값을 검색하기 위해 데이터베이스에서 실행 중인 SQL 선택 쿼리입니다. 예를 들어 select * <테이블 이름>입니다.

  • keyColumnName. 키 쌍 값에 대한 키인 데이터베이스 열의 이름입니다.

  • valueColumnName. 값을 검색하는 데이터베이스 열의 이름입니다.

Blueprint 구성

사용자 지정 속성을 [Blueprint 속성] 탭에 추가하려면 Blueprint 시스템 속성으로 사용자 지정 속성 또는 속성 그룹 추가 항목을 참조하십시오.